Commercial Slab Construction in Davis County, UT

Commercial slab construction services involve the preparation and pouring of concrete slabs that serve as the foundation for various types of commercial buildings, such as warehouses, retail stores, and office spaces. These projects typically require precise planning and execution to ensure a stable, level base that can support the structure's weight and meet safety standards. Property owners often seek information on the scope of the work, including site preparation, reinforcement, and finishing details, as well as considerations like soil conditions and load requirements to ensure the durability and longevity of the foundation.

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ners usually want to understand the specific process involved, the materials used, and any site-specific factors that could influence the project. It's important to consider the size and design of the slab, as well as any additional features such as insulation or drainage systems. Clarifying these details helps ensure the foundation will meet the needs of the building and comply with local building codes and regulations.

FAQ

Commercial Slab Construction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or storage spaces on commercial properties.

What should property owners consider before construction? It's important to evaluate soil conditions, load requirements, and drainage needs to ensure a durable and functional slab design.

How does the slab construction process work? The process typically involves site preparation, forming, reinforcement placement, pouring concrete, and curing to create a solid, level surface.

What are common materials used in commercial slabs? Reinforced concrete is the standard material, often combined with steel reinforcement to enhance strength and longevity.
